My folks came to visit with their brand new Buick Rendevous. Same thing happened to them. Parked the card in the shed during a storm, and a rat built a nest overnight, and chewed wires. Mom was hotter than a 2 dollar pistol on the fourth of July. Brought it to the dealer. Dealer did not cover it under warranty either. Mom was even hotter at that point.
Dealer says that rats are attracted to the vegetable oil base used in new car wiring harnesses. I don't know if that part is accurate, but that is what the dealer said. Cost her around $160 bucks to get it fixed. I put out rat bait poison the next day.
